Daily Archives: November 20, 2015

The Catholic Church Doth Protest Too Much, Methinks.

by | November 20, 2015

A colleague from the Canadian atheist, secular, humanist, freethinking community alerted me to the article “Paris Attacks in God’s Name ‘Blasphemy’” using the subject line “Ironic News article”: The militants behind the Paris attacks that killed at least 129 people are “violating the image of God” by claiming to carry out such acts of violence in… Read more »